The Lions have built a playoff team. Not quite a Superbowl caliber team but a good team nonetheless. Letting Goff walk and drafting his replacement is risky. You never know how long it will take for a young guy to develop into a good quarterback. It could set them back and maybe even ruin any chance of a Superbowl appearance if they draft the wrong guy. With Goff you know what you're getting. And he's certainly capable of winning enough games. Who knows, maybe he could pull a Flacco or Foles and get hot at the right time.

Goff has the same, if not better weapons around him as he did with the Rams. Montgomery and Gibbs in the backfield. Neither are Todd Gurley but both together are the equivalent. If they remain more healthy than Gurley that's a plus. He's got no Kupp but St. Brown, Williams, Josh Reynolds and Kalif Raymond are plenty. I don't know what Peoples-Jones will bring but that's not a bad receiving corp. LaPorta is already a better receiver than Higbee or Everett. Good enough for them to trade Hockenson. How good he is at blocking is unclear to me but I doubt he's on Higs level there. Lastly, he's got a good young OL. That group (WR, RB, OL, QB) should do well if they're together for the next 2 -3 years. It could be the only clock ticking for Goff is the one that asks, when will you get back to the SB?
